技术文摘
PyCharm 远程调试:灵蛇翱翔
PyCharm 远程调试:灵蛇翱翔
在当今数字化的时代,软件开发的效率和质量成为了关键。而 PyCharm 作为一款强大的 Python 集成开发环境(IDE),其远程调试功能犹如灵蛇翱翔,为开发者带来了极大的便利和灵活性。
远程调试允许开发者在本地的 PyCharm 中直接调试运行在远程服务器上的代码。这对于那些需要处理大规模数据、依赖特定服务器环境或者进行分布式计算的项目来说,是一项不可或缺的能力。
想象一下,您正在处理一个复杂的机器学习项目,数据存储在远程的高性能服务器上。以往,您可能需要在服务器上手动进行调试,查看日志,这不仅繁琐而且效率低下。有了 PyCharm 的远程调试,您可以像在本地调试一样,设置断点、查看变量值、单步执行代码,快速定位和解决问题。
配置远程调试环境并非难事。您需要在远程服务器上安装必要的调试工具,并在 PyCharm 中进行相关的连接设置,包括服务器的地址、端口、认证信息等。一旦配置完成,您就可以轻松地在本地与远程环境之间建立起调试的桥梁。
在实际调试过程中,PyCharm 提供了直观清晰的界面,让您能够实时监控代码的执行状态。当代码在远程服务器上运行到断点处时,您可以在本地查看相关的变量和调用栈信息,从而深入了解代码的运行逻辑。这种实时的反馈机制,大大缩短了调试的周期,提高了开发效率。
而且,PyCharm 的远程调试功能还支持与版本控制系统的集成。这意味着您可以在调试的方便地对比不同版本的代码,确保您的修改不会引入新的问题。
PyCharm 的远程调试功能如同一条灵动的蛇,在复杂的开发环境中自由翱翔,为开发者提供了强大的武器,帮助他们更高效、更轻松地应对各种挑战。无论是开发大型项目,还是进行跨平台的开发工作,PyCharm 的远程调试都能成为您的得力助手,让您的开发之旅更加顺畅、高效。
TAGS: 代码调试技巧 PyCharm 远程调试 远程开发工具 灵蛇翱翔
- MySQL 中单句实现无限层次父子关系查询的方法
- SQL Server 2008执行计划中处理隐式数据类型转换的增强
- 利用mysql判断点是否处于指定多边形区域内
- 更新锁(U)与排它锁(X)知识讲解
- 无法锁住的查询
- 深入解析 SQL Server 索引原理:小编带你探索
- 深入解析 MySQL 索引底层实现原理
- MySQL实现查询结果导出为CSV文件与导入CSV文件到数据库的操作
- SQL 与 MyBatis 中的正则表达式应用
- MySQL基础知识点
- MySQL 增删改查的常用语法
- 怎样高效达成应用mysql的增删改查功能
- MySQL多表连接查询实操案例
- MySQL基础知识点全梳理
- MySQL面试题汇总